Beverly J. Simmons
Kensington – Beverly J. Simmons, 78, of Kensington died Thursday, October 30, 2014 at the Lahey Clinic in Burlington, MA.
She was born March 28, 1936 in Boston, MA the daughter of the late Benjamin and Helen (McGrath) Trottier.
She was raised in Boston and was a graduate of Boston High School. She lived most of her life in Exeter and resided in Kensington for the past 10 years. She was the first female toll taker and supervisor at the Hampton Tool Booths.
She was a devoted wife, mother, grandmother and great grandmother who enjoyed spending time with her family, reading and gardening.
